The Schwartz-Jampel Syndrome (SJS) is a very rare condition characterised by Constant fìndings such as typical facial appearance, muscle hypertrophy and continuous muscle activity. Other fìndings are more or less frequently associated, especially skeletai abnormalities, including dwarfism or anyway short stature. We describe five patients with Schwartz-Jampel syndrome (SJS) examined at the outpatient service for neuromuscular disorders at our Institution from 1996 to 1999 with the objective of emphasizing the characteristic dysmorphic phenotype of SJS and its different clinical forms.
